NICET Fire Alarm Level 1 Exam Overview and Structure

installation focused nfpa 72 exam

When you take the NICET Fire Alarm Level 1 exam, you’ll find it structured to assess your knowledge primarily in installation, maintenance, and submittal preparation.

The exam’s content divides roughly into 50% installation, 40% maintenance, and 10% submittal preparation and system layout. This weighting reflects the practical demands you’ll face in the field.

The current exam aligns with the latest 2022 edition of NFPA 72, emphasizing code compliance and technical accuracy. You’ll need to navigate NFPA 72’s chapter organization and index efficiently, as the test is open book.

Preparation involves mastering key technical topics such as circuit classifications, pathway survivability, voltage drop calculations, and riser diagrams. Efficient time management during the exam requires flagging questions and leveraging codebook tabbing for quick reference.

NICET Fire Alarm Level 1 Circuit Classifications and Notification Circuits

When you work with fire alarm systems, understanding circuit classifications is essential to guarantee proper installation and compliance with NFPA 72.

Circuit classes like Class A and Class B define the wiring path and fault tolerance. Class A circuits provide two-way communication, allowing the system to maintain operation even if a single open or ground fault occurs.

Class B circuits, however, offer a single path and may lose functionality if interrupted. Notification circuits power devices like horns, strobes, and speakers, requiring careful voltage drop calculations and conduit fill considerations.

Key points to remember:

  • Class A circuits loop back to the panel for survivability
  • Class B circuits have a single path, simpler but less fault tolerant
  • Notification circuits must meet voltage and current specifications per NFPA 72

Reading Riser Diagrams and Floor Plans for NICET Exams

Mastering how to read riser diagrams and floor plans is essential for accurately interpreting fire alarm system layouts on the NICET exam. You’ll need to identify device locations, circuit paths, and panel connections quickly.

Master reading riser diagrams and floor plans to quickly identify devices, circuits, and panel connections on the NICET exam.

Focus on recognizing symbols for detectors, notification appliances, and control modules as defined in NFPA 72. Understand how riser diagrams illustrate vertical wiring routes between floors, showing Class A and Class B circuit styles, conduit runs, and power supplies.

Floor plans complement this by mapping horizontal device placement and pathway routing. Practicing these skills improves your ability to visualize system design and troubleshoot potential issues.

During the exam, efficiently cross-reference diagrams with NFPA code sections to confirm compliance requirements. Developing speed and accuracy here directly impacts your performance in the system layout domain.

Maintenance and Testing Protocols Per NFPA 72

Adhere strictly to Chapter 14 of NFPA 72, which outlines the mandatory inspection, testing, and maintenance protocols for fire alarm systems.

You must follow prescribed intervals found in Tables 14.3.1 and 14.4.3.2 for visual inspections and functional testing respectively.

Perform tests on notification appliances, control units, and power supplies, verifying battery capacity per standby and alarm requirements.

Document all maintenance actions systematically to support compliance and future inspections.

Use a scheduled approach to make certain no component is overlooked, focusing on pathway survivability and circuit integrity.

Your testing should identify open circuits, ground faults, and device failures promptly.

Are There Any Hands-On Practical Components in the NICET Fire Alarm Level 1 Exam?

You won’t encounter hands-on practical components in the NICET Fire Alarm Level 1 exam. Instead, you’ll navigate through a rigorous written test, flipping pages in your codebooks as you solve circuit classifications, calculate voltage drops, and interpret riser diagrams.

Your skills are tested on knowledge and application, not physical installation. So, focus on mastering code navigation, calculations, and troubleshooting techniques to confidently pass this paper-based, open-book exam.
